- Synopsis
- With mom abroad for a year with her new husband, Josh and Sam must stay with their remarried dad and two stepbrothers in Florida. The stepbrothers continually mock Sam, calling him a homosexual because he hates athletics -- especially football. When Josh and Sam fly back to their California home to pick up extra clothes, Sam tells Josh that he's not human, but a Strategically Altered Mutant (S.A.M.) wanted by the government. The only escape is to flee to Canada. Fortunately, their flight lands briefly in Texas, and the two take advantage of the stop to run away. While on the road, Josh and Sam learn that looking out for each other gets you farther than just looking out for yourself.
